Abstract:
The invention relates to a method of communicating between at least two devices, comprising in particular the following steps: a step of hooking up a first device and at least one second device, and a step of transferring a first multimedia stream from the first device to the second device, characterized in that it also comprises the following steps: a step of determining, in the course of which it is noted that the first device or a first communication network to which the first device is connected or a second network to which the second device is connected is adapted for the production or transfer of a multimedia stream comprising N channels, and that the second device comprises means for processing a multimedia stream comprising P channels, and a step of trunking a second multimedia stream to the second device, carried out in parallel with the step of transferring the first multimedia stream. The invention also relates to an associated communication system. Application to telephony or videophony over IP.
Abstract:
A method is provided for updating a data-rendering device connected to a communications network by an intermediate device. A specific electronic address is assigned to the data-rendering device. The method includes associating at least one identifier, preliminarily assigned to the intermediate device, with the electronic address. The at least one identifier belongs to the group including at least: one dynamic connection identifier of the intermediate device and one user account identifier (AID).
Abstract:
A method that may be implemented in a CSCF entity to acknowledge a REGISTER type request sent by a terminal. It comprises: a step (E30) of estimating, for at least one future time window, the number of REGISTER requests that are liable to be received by the CSCF entity during said future time window; a step of selecting a future time window; and a step (E110) of sending to the sending terminal an acknowledgment message (200, 503) including a period (EXPIRES) selected so that the next REGISTER request sent by that terminal will be sent during said selected future window.
Abstract:
A data exchange system on a data transfer network (2) between a receiver station (6) and a data (I*) server (4) with conditional access, wherein data exchanges over the network (2) are managed and authorized by a control server (20). The control server (20) is associated with: automatic elements (7, 22, 24) forming a catalogue of useable access instruments, accessible to a user of the receiver station (6) for selection, by the user, of one of the access instruments; automatic elements (26) for determining corresponding control parameters of data exchange control over the network (2); and automatic elements (28) for controlling data exchanges over the network (2) based on the thus determined parameters.

Abstract:
A method of transmitting an indication inhibiting at least one service associated with a called device, the method including a step for generating a call signal (4001) in order to set up a communication between a calling device and the called device via at least one communication network. Such a method also comprises a substitution step (4005), to be executed when said call signal comprises an inhibiting command, and during which said inhibiting command is replaced by said inhibiting indication.
Abstract:
An SIP message processing method is disclosed. It may be performed by a node of a telecommunications network having a home gateway connected to an IMS network core via an access connection, at least a first SIP terminal and a second SIP terminal locally connected to said home gateway. It may include obtaining a bandwidth of the access connection, receiving a first SIP message concerning the first SIP session, determining the bandwidth in use by the first SIP session as a function of the first SIP message, receiving a second SIP message concerning the second SIP session, determining a bandwidth authorized for the second SIP session as a function of the second SIP message, of the bandwidth of the access connection, and of the bandwidth in use by the first SIP session, and sending a third SIP message to the first terminal, the second terminal, or the IMS network core.
Abstract:
A method and apparatus are provided for processing a request to instigate communication, received by a routing device associated with a plurality of terminals. The request relates to a communication to be established between a sender device of the request and at least one of the terminals. The method includes a step of comparing communication capabilities of said sender device with respective communication capabilities of one or more terminals, called addressee terminals, which are able to establish said communication, so as to identify at least one terminal having capabilities making it possible to establish with the sender device a communication of maximum quality. A call notification is transmitted to at least one of the addressee terminals, which is suitable for triggering on the addressee terminal a call presentation prompting a user to use, by priority, one of the terminals identified during the comparison step to establish the communication.
Abstract:
A method of transferring an audio stream between at least two terminals, comprising the following steps: a step of connecting a first device and at least a second device; and a step of transferring an audio stream from the first device to the second device; the method being characterized in that it further comprises the following steps: a determination step during which it is determined that the first device or a first network to which the first device is connected or a second network to which the second device is connected is adapted to produce or transfer an audio stream comprising N channels and that the second device includes an electroacoustic transducer adapted to receive an audio stream comprising P channels; and a conversion step during which an audio stream sent by the first device or transmitted by the first network or transmitted by the second network is converted into an audio stream comprising P channels. An associated transfer system is also disclosed. Application to telephone or videophone communication in IP networks.
Abstract:
A method and apparatus are provided for management of registrations in an IMS network. The method includes: creating, for a given public identity, at least two registration queues, each one being associated with a registration policy; receiving a registration message sent by a terminal having the public identity; and assigning one of the registration queues to the terminal on the basis of a field included in the message.
